is a visceral exploration of the systematic destruction of innocence within the decaying urban landscape of Mumbai's chawls. Directed by Mahesh Manjrekar and based on a story by the late journalist Jayant Pawar , the film serves as a brutal post-script to the socio-economic collapse of the city’s mill worker communities.
